N-Gage QD - Worth It At $99?
Thanks to GameSpot for its article discussing the possible pricing for Nokia's enhanced N-Gage QD mobile phone/game deck combo, which "will arrive in the Western Hemisphere on June 29, where units will sell for a list price of $199." Although "Reports from Europe and Asia--by way of CNN--indicate that foreign mobile phone networks are heavily subsidizing the QD in exchange for extended service contracts", the U.S. price is not yet known - the article points out: "When the QD was initially unveiled, Nokia publicly stated that it expected a carrier-subsidized $99 price point to be common."
